My baby is 4 month old and his weight is 5kg. His birth weight was 2.9kgs. Is this normal?

A. Very good weight in your child has because your child is actually gaining appropriately as per the expectation that is seen in a month which is about 500 g so if you look at it your child has gained 2100 g in four months which is ideally the right amount of weight gain
